HUGE UPDATE!!!!
item 1:
I modified the design for the shell somewhat to simplify the design and make it easier to get close to OEM appearance. the front face and rim peice are now one peice, i need to tweak it a little more but in my testing there was no problem getting the gp2x board in and out and the lines will be much cleaner!

item 2:
Ive modified the leading (bottom) edge of the face with a new feature, its gonna need some tweaking but i think it REALLY brings the whole new look together. mad props to dragonhead for the idea!

item3:
THE DPAD MOD WORKS!! wired it up and tested it tonight and worked perfectly first time around!
